Object 1 rolls up the incline without slipping. Object 2 rolls down the incline without slipping.

Object 1 is a solid sphere and has mass 2kg and radius R1

Object 2 is a hoop of mass 1kg and radius R2

Object 3 is a disk that is mounted on a frictionless axle through its CM. It has mass 4kg and radius R3 (this disk acts as a pulley. It only rotates)

Note: ropes are attached to axles through CM's

Theta = 30 degree
Phi =60 degree

Find the acceleration of mass 2.
